screw jack actuators are a type of mechanical actuator that convert rotary motion into linear motion through the use of a screw shaft. These devices are commonly used in a wide range of applications, including manufacturing, construction, automotive, and aerospace industries. The screw jack actuator offers several advantages over other types of actuators, including high load capacity, precision control, and mechanical simplicity.
One of the key benefits of a screw jack actuator is its ability to support heavy loads with ease. The design of the screw shaft allows for a large amount of weight to be lifted or lowered, making these actuators ideal for applications that require lifting and positioning of heavy objects. screw jack actuators are commonly used in automotive lifts, industrial machinery, and construction equipment where heavy loads need to be moved and positioned accurately.
In addition to their high load capacity, screw jack actuators also offer precise control over the motion of the load. By rotating the screw shaft, operators can control the linear movement of the load with a high degree of accuracy. This level of precision makes screw jack actuators ideal for applications that require exact positioning, such as robotic arms, assembly lines, and medical equipment.
Another advantage of screw jack actuators is their mechanical simplicity. Unlike hydraulic or pneumatic actuators, screw jack actuators do not require complex systems of valves, hoses, and pumps to operate. This makes screw jack actuators easier to maintain and repair, as well as more cost-effective than other types of actuators. In addition, the straightforward design of screw jack actuators makes them more durable and reliable in harsh operating conditions.

Screw jack actuators can also be equipped with additional features to enhance their performance and functionality. For example, some screw jack actuators are equipped with integrated limit switches to automatically stop the actuator when it reaches a certain position. Others are equipped with encoder feedback systems to provide real-time position feedback for precise control of the load. These additional features make screw jack actuators even more versatile and useful in a wide range of applications.
